Sed0017876 (gene) Chayote v1

Overview
NameSed0017876
Typegene
OrganismSechium edule (Chayote v1)
DescriptionRas-related protein RABH1b
LocationLG05: 2013155 .. 2018790 (-)

GO Annotation
GO Assignments
This gene is annotated with the following GO terms.
Category Term Accession Term Name
biological_process GO:0006886 intracellular protein transport
biological_process GO:0006891 intra-Golgi vesicle-mediated transport
biological_process GO:0042147 retrograde transport, endosome to Golgi
biological_process GO:0006890 retrograde vesicle-mediated transport, Golgi to endoplasmic reticulum
cellular_component GO:0005829 cytosol
cellular_component GO:0005794 Golgi apparatus
molecular_function GO:0003924 GTPase activity
molecular_function GO:0005525 GTP binding
